If a window is cloudy glass, it may be due to the seal inside the glass breaking down. This can allow moisture to enter the room and could be a problem for homeowners who live in the area. Some companies will tell you that this issue can be solved by drilling a hole through the glass and sucking out the moisture, but this method is not efficient, and could damage the frame of the u p v c window repairs.

Wood windows made of old-growth wood can last a lifetime if they are properly maintained and properly restored. However the National Park Service's Preservation Brief 9: The Repair of Old Wooden Windows recommends replacing a component that has become damaged, such as a muntin or sill, rather than the entire window. Restoration experts can do this while maintaining the look of an historic building and avoiding waste from unnecessary replacements.
